Output ff56a3616b819b0059e804ee34d89eb4a6290fdca59eaea0f2dc5ba16aa1e403:1

value
11783412
script pubkey
OP_0 OP_PUSHBYTES_20 a653632fafc9634aa4c011436ac2da6ce50f8bcb
address
bc1q5efkxta0e9354fxqz9pk4sk6dnjslz7t3nesv6
transaction
ff56a3616b819b0059e804ee34d89eb4a6290fdca59eaea0f2dc5ba16aa1e403
confirmations
61574
spent
true